Beyond IQ

Traditional assessments often focus solely on cognitive ability as measured by IQ scores. However, this narrow view fails to capture the complete range of human capability. Howard Gardner's theory of various intellectual strengths revolutionized our understanding of intelligence by proposing that individuals possess distinct aptitudes in diverse areas.

  • Verbal intelligence encompasses the ability to use copyright effectively.
  • Logical-Mathematical intelligence deals with problem-solving and mathematical concepts.
  • Visual-Spatial intelligence entails the ability to visualize objects in space .
  • Physical intelligence relates to movement and proficiency.

By recognizing these multiple intelligences, educators have the ability to adapt their teaching methods to cater to the specific needs of each student.
